Anyone interested in the automobile thing, the is the place YOU HAVE TO COME AND VISIT!!"The Toyota Automobile Museum was established to commemorate the history of automobile and is dedicated to building a properous future for man and motor car."Hours -- 9:30-17:00 (Last admission 30 minutes before closing)Closed on Monday (when a National Holiday falls on a Monday, the museum will be closed on the following day) and during the New Year’s holiday.Admission -- 1000 Yen per adult

Bungy Jumping

by misakitaguchi

You must try bangy jumping at "Minamichita-greenbarley." If you visit Aichi pre.It was first time to tried bungy for me but I think it was not so scared.It's just 20m. You stand up and when you prepared,and then hands up. It's a sigh." I am ready!!!" And worker will say "3..2..1...BUNGY!!!!!" Then you have to jump from head,legs or back. It is so excited. I tried 2times. HA HA! One jump is about $10 . But if you buy passport you can choose several attractions. Passport is about $30. I also tried another one call by "SKY COASTER" It's also great. The high is 32m. I think these scary attraction gives me great experience. And my stress have gone!! If you interested in it, just try and jump!
